Job Role s and Responsibilities

Manage specialized geotechnical construction projects from planning through completion.

Oversee foundation support, ground stabilization, earth retention, and subsurface remediation projects.

Prepare project estimates, budgets, schedules, and manpower plans.

Lead and supervise field crews, drillers, equipment operators, and technicians.

Conduct field visits and provide technical direction during construction.

Coordinate with engineers, clients, and project stakeholders.

Ensure installation of micropiles, helical piles, soil nails, tiebacks, grouting systems, and other geotechnical elements according to specifications.

Monitor project schedules, equipment utilization, and daily operations.

Perform quality assurance and quality control inspections.

Maintain project documentation, logs, and reports.

Ensure compliance with OSHA and applicable safety regulations.

Resolve field issues while maintaining productivity, quality, and profitability.

Qualifications and Certifications

Minimum 5 years of progressive geotechnical construction management experience.

Hands-on field experience in geotechnical construction is required.

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, Geotechnical Engineering, or a related field preferred.

Professional Engineer (PE) or Engineer in Training (EIT) certification preferred.

Experience with construction estimating and engineering design.

Strong knowledge of deep foundations, ground improvement, shoring systems, and geotechnical construction methods.

Experience interpreting structural drawings and geotechnical reports.

Familiarity with heavy drilling equipment and specialized construction machinery.

Valid Driver's License with a clean driving record.

OSHA 30-Hour, HAZWOPER, PMP, or other construction safety certifications preferred.

Ability to pass medical and physical fitness requirements.
